Abstract

fibras infundidas com cnt em matrizes termoplásticas. a presente invenção refere-se a um compósito que inclui um material de matriz termoplástica e um material de fibra de vidro infundido com nanotubo de carbono (cnt) disperso através de, pelo menos uma parte do material de matriz termoplástica.
